Biggest surprise for me was that apple is still supporting 6s and SE for ios15. More than 6 years of updates. I was expecting they will be dropped this year(spatial audio stuff etc is iPhone 7 and later, people were taking it as a signal to end of general updates too later)

Edit- iPad Air 2 also supported. That’s from 2014!

I hope experience doesn’t degrade, I would recommend users of these devices to wait and watch a few ios15 reviews for that device before updating. Apple does support for quite some time, but has a history of causing problems on oldest supported devices.
